titleOfInvention Novel cephalosporin derivative or salt thereof
abstract (57) [Summary] (with correction) [Solution] The following formula [Wherein, R 1 is an optionally substituted alkylthio, Aryl and the like; R 2 is a carboxyl group or a carboxylate group which may be protected; R 3 is a hydrogen atom or an alkyl group which may be substituted; R 4 is a hydrogen atom, an alkyl group or a cyano group; R 5 is a hydrogen atom, a cyano group, an optionally protected hydroxyl group or the like; Is an optionally protected hydroxyimino group, an optionally substituted alkoxyimino group, etc .; the double bond present at the substituted thio bonded to the 3-position of the cephem ring is E-configuration or Z-configuration or a mixture thereof. Is shown. ] The cephalosporin derivative represented by these, or its salt. The novel cephalosporin derivative or a salt thereof has a wide antibacterial spectrum and a strong antibacterial activity, and particularly has a strong antibacterial activity against MRSA, and is useful as an antibacterial agent.
